Lewiston City Officials Warn Residents of Limited Services on Election Day


Lewiston - Officials in Lewiston are telling residents to be prepared for reduced and slowed city services on Election Day.

City Clerk Kathy Montejo says the city uses many city employees to help work at the seven polling places to assist voters with election services on Tuesday.

Those workers staff the polls from 7 a.m. through 8 p.m. and as a result, services in various city departments will be slower due to limited remaining staff coverage.

She suggests that people needing to do business with the city wait until Wednesday when city departments are fully staffed again.

For those who just can't wait. All city operations will be functioning, just with a smaller staff than usual.

Residents with questions can call City Hall at 513-3000.
